87.97 percent of the population in 77471 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 54.27 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 8.73 percent of the residents in 77471 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.56 members with about 2.02 cars available per household.
An estimate of 80.91 percent of the residents in 77471 has some form of health insurance. 33.27 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 54.27 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 77471 would have to travel an average of 3.80 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Oakbend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 77471, Rosenberg, Texas.

As of , an estimate of 41,723 residents live in 77471 with a median age of 32.4 years. 27.07 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 13.07 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 40.61 percent of the residents in 77471 is currently married, and 21.62 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 77471 is $5,587.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 77471 is approximately $1,189. The median household spends about 21.28 percent of their income on housing.

The history of Rosenberg adds another layer of appeal for potential residents. Founded in 1883 as a railroad town along the Gulf, Colorado and Santa Fe Railway, Rosenberg has grown into a vibrant community with a rich cultural heritage. The city has preserved its historic downtown area while embracing modern development, offering residents a blend of old-world charm and contemporary amenities.
